Hostel In-Reach Worker (Rough Sleeping Drug & Alcohol Team)

Job Type: Full Time, 12 Months Fixed Term
Location: Canterbury
Salary: £24,000 per annum

Are you dedicated to making a positive impact through helping others and seeking a fresh challenge?

Would you thrive in an environment that recognizes your worth and allows you to contribute meaningfully?

Welcome to The Forward Trust, an organization committed to facilitating transformation for individuals trapped in cycles of crime and addiction. With over 25 years of experience, we empower individuals to embrace change and build fulfilling lives, irrespective of their past. We firmly believe in the potential for enduring personal growth in everyone. Our array of services has enabled countless individuals to embark on constructive journeys, establishing connections, and cultivating a sense of community.

We are devoted to offering equal opportunities to individuals from all walks of life, including those with 'Lived Experience.' We strongly encourage applications from diverse backgrounds, including individuals in recovery from addiction, co-dependency, or homelessness, as well as those with a history of previous offenses.

Key Responsibilities
  • Conduct assessments to inform treatment plans for service users.
  • Deliver tailored interventions to meet individual needs, encompassing both one-on-one and group sessions.
  • Collaborate with external agencies to address client requirements comprehensively.
  • Coordinate healthcare efforts to oversee client well-being and mitigate risks.
  • Contribute to the assessment and care planning processes, ensuring holistic support for service users.
  • Motivate clients to engage with the services outlined in their care plans.
Requirements
  • Prior experience in substance misuse services.
  • Proficiency in conducting assessments, risk management, and developing SMART care plans.
  • Experience in providing structured interventions to service users.
  • Utilization of motivational interviewing techniques in various settings.
  • Strong IT competencies.
  • Understanding of continuity of care, holistic needs, and community services.
  • Promotion of Equality and Diversity.
  • Familiarity with issues affecting substance misusers, the Recovery agenda, and Safeguarding practices.
